About the Role

UST is searching for a strong Java Full Stack Developer to work on a multi-vendor, multi-geo team helping to build a NextGen High Scale Enterprise Platform.

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, test, and maintain scalable web applications using Spring Boot, Node.js, and React.js.
  • Develop and consume RESTful APIs to enable seamless integration between front-end and back-end systems.
  • Build and maintain microservices-based applications using Spring Boot and Java best practices.
  • Develop server-side applications using Node.js, ensuring efficient asynchronous processing and high performance.
  • Design and implement responsive, user-friendly interfaces using React.js, including component development, state management, and routing.
  • Utilize Microsoft Azure services such as Azure App Service, Azure Functions, and Azure SQL Database for cloud-native application development and deployment.
  • Implement Object-Relational Mapping (ORM) frameworks and manage database interactions effectively.
  • Hands-on experience in developing Spring Boot applications, including dependency injection, ORM (Object-Relational Mapping), and REST API development.
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Azure cloud platform, including Azure App Service, Azure Functions, and Azure SQL.
  • Proficiency in building server-side applications using NodeJS, including creating RESTful APIs and handling asynchronous programming.
  • In-depth understanding of JavaScript fundamentals, including ES6+ features, data types, operators, and functional programming concepts.
  • Familiarity with Continuous Integration (CI) and Continuous Deployment (CD) practices, including automated testing, build pipelines, and deployment strategies.
  • Proficiency in writing SQL queries as per industrial standards, fine-tuned for optimization.
  • Strong knowledge and experience in developing front-end applications using ReactJS, including components, state management, and routing.
  • Strong problem-solving abilities, good communication (written & verbal) skills, and the ability to work effectively in a team.

Requirements

  • 10+ years of experience in software development.
  • 5 years of hands-on experience in Java development at enterprise scale (recent).
  • 3 years of recent React experience.
  • Strong programming skills in Java, React, and Node, including object-oriented programming principles, design patterns, and familiarity with Java frameworks.
  • Understanding of microservices architecture and experience in building and deploying microservices-based applications.
